Let's now take a look at GPU temperatures using this port, to see how the Sapphire Radeon HD 4850 TOXIC, and more specifically its third-party Zalman cooler, handles any heat generated by the RV770 core. We'll be examining GPU temperatures first after idling at a Windows Vista desktop for a few minutes, and then again after thirty minutes under load via looping 3DMark06's 3D game tests.
As the chart shows, the difference between AMD's reference cooler and the Zalman part sported by the Radeon HD 4850 TOXIC is night and day. Even with the higher clock speeds of the TOXIC, this board demonstrates the kind of temperatures we should have been seeing from the Radeon HD 4850 from the very start. At idle, the TOXIC sits at a far more respectable temperature level, and by the time it's been put under an intensive graphics rendering workload for half an hour, it manages to keep the GPU over twenty degrees cooler.
